The Optimization Problem Of Matlab Routines
Relevant numerical techniques, which have been done with the help of MATLAB routines, are
applied to solve the arising optimization problem and to find the optimum parameters of the TMD.
For a given mass ratio, Вµ, one can assume different values of the frequency ratio, f, and for each
frequency ratio assuming a range of dampingfactor О¶2 of the TMD and estimate the optimum
parameters that minimize a certain desired output. Fig. 8 is an example of the numerical
optimizationconducted to estimate the optimal frequency ratio and damping factor of the TMD for
two different mass ratios under windloads modeled as white noise. The optimization is based on the
minimization of the displacement of the primary structure. In this numerical optimization, the
responses of the primary structure are normalized, which means that the response obtained with the
TMD when attached to the structure is divided by the corresponding response obtained without the
TMD. The optimal values of the frequency ratio and the damping factor of the TMD are written on
the subfigures. It is shown that a TMD with 1% mass ratio can provide a significant reduction in
the displacement response of the primary structure. The reduction in the displacement depends very
much on the tuning frequency and the damping ratio of the TMD. By increasing the mass ratio
from 1% to 5%, the displacement response of the primary structure is reduced. However, the TMD
with 5% mass ratio is more robust to the changes in the frequency

Yersinia pestisis is a highly infectious, Gram negative bacillus that is transmitted to humans usually
through the bite of infected fleas. [1]. Yersinia pestisis reaching the respiratory tract results in
pneumonic plague, which is also highly contagious due to its airborne transmission. [1]. Pneumonic
plagueusually causes fatality in less than three days if no treatment is administered. [1]. Plague has
been one of the deadliest bacterial infections in human history, causing millions of deaths during
three major historical pandemics. Well known for killing millions of people in the Middle Ages in
Europe, the Yersinia pestisis bacteria, or bubonic plagueas it is perhaps most commonly known, is
effectively treated today. Three major

The Spectroscopy Lab Centralized On The Properties Of Waves
The spectroscopy lab centralized on the properties of waves and they relate to the emission
spectrum, however one must understand the Bohr model of the atom first. The Bohr model for the
atom depicts a planetary like structure, with a positively charged nucleus in the center with small,
negatively charged electrons rotating around in specific, fixed orbits at different distances from the
nucleus. When an electrontransitions from a higher orbital, where it is in its excited state, back
down to a lower orbital where it is relaxed or in its ground state, it emits light. The emitted light is a
result of the electron releasing the previously absorbed energy. It is possible to observe an
electron in one state or another, however an electron never possesses the capability to be observed
in between states. Transitions between states that are closer together, produce a light of lower
energy transitions of a longer distance.
A spectroscope is able to display the emitted light by presenting the bright interference patterns of
the diverse wavelengths which make up the spectrum. By looking through the eyepiece, a spectrum
will appear on either side of the slit the slit starts all of the light waves passing down the tube in
phase so that they arrive at the slits in the diffraction grating at the same time. When wavelengths
are in phase, they create constructive interference, which results in double the amplification, while
wave lengths that are out of phase produce destructive

Pathogenesis Of Arthrosclerosis
The pathogenesis of arthrosclerosis is a progressive disease of the vascular system, it starts while
we are young and progresses throughout our lives. The progression of arthrosclerosis, starts with an
injury to the endothelial lining of the arteries, from such diseases as, hypertension, high cholesterol,
diabetes and smoking. The damage to the endothelial cells causes dysfunction and the area with
endothelial cell inflammation draws leukocytes, cholesterol, vascular smooth muscle cells and
other debris, the buildup creates atherosclerotic plaque deposits in areas on an arterywall causing an
inflammatory process (Hoffman, 2007).
Over time the buildup of plaque on the artery walls produces hardening of the vessel walls and
blockages that slow the flow of blood throughout the body. Arthrosclerosis affects the heart,
peripheral arteries and the carotid and cerebral arteries that supply blood flow to the brain
(Arthrosclerosis, 2014). The effect on the body from arthrosclerosis causes other diseases to form,
peripheral vascular disease, coronary artery disease, hypertension, renal disease and stroke (Story,
2011). If the plaque buildup ruptures or breaks off, it forms a thrombus or blood clot that can cause
a stroke, heart attack or even death. 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
